Chinese
Glyph origin
Corrupted form of 㜛.
Etymology 1
Unclear. Possibly as variant of 耎 (OC) ~ 輭 (OC *nonʔ); alternatively, related to Burmese နုန့် (nun., “weak, exhausted from illness”), yet this meaning barely overlaps with "soft to touch" (Schuessler, 2007).

Definitions
嫩
- tender; delicate
- inexperienced; unskilled
- (of food) tender; soft
- (of colour) light
- (Eastern Min) small
